Bad breath
Age 26, male, want to get rid of bad breath from mouth and yellow teeth, i brush two times but not solved, please suggest what should I do

Yellow teeth has got plaque a thin film formed on the teeth  and there might be a calcified , stonelike structure called the tartar or calculus ,which are not good for oral health so it requires cleaning by the therapist. The therapist or dentist will remove it with or without medication depending upon the condition of the gums & oral hygiene. This will definitely solve the issue.

Hello dear, Pleasee be calm See bad breath or halitosis is due to variety of reasons ranging from systemic factors like liver and diabetes mellitus to local factors like calculus, caries and extraction socket. Diagnosis is must to determine the exact etiology of halitosis

Bad breath is caused by mainly because of... Lack of oral hygiene Unclean tongue and oral soft tissues Teeth decay Other reasons include... Dry mouth Less water consumption Medicines Systemic diseases Mouth breathing Gastric regurgitation Find the reason/reasons of your bad breath with help of doctor then treatment will be decided accordingly. Bad breath or halitosis can be due to a wide variety of causes both local and systemic. However the most common cause is poor oral hygiene. This leads to plaque ,calculus,gum disease all of which lead to halitosis. So as a first step I suggest you visit a dentist to get tooth cleaning(scaling) done followed by polishing of your teeth. The dentist will also advise you on the oral hygiene procedures to be followed including proper brushing technique.
